full-stack developer

To learn the basics Middle/Senior Full Stack Developer (C# / Vue.js) job of HTML, freeCodeCamp has a HTML Crash Course for Beginners – Website Tutorial. All of the buttons, text, colors, and layout are the job of the front end developer. Front end developers also have to make sure the website looks good on all devices (phones, tablets, and computer screens). Full-stack development is one of the most challenging but rewarding roles because it combines crucial front- and back-end development responsibilities. Full-stack developers are a combination of front-end and back-end developers. In this module, you will be assessed on the key skills covered in the course.

Java Full Stack Developer Roadmap for 2025

full-stack developer

This section lays the groundwork for building the user interface, the visual layer that users interact programmer skills with on a website. Here, you’ll delve into the essential technologies that bring websites to life,  transforming a blank canvas into an engaging and interactive experience. This Java Full Stack Developer roadmap has been meticulously crafted through extensive research into emerging technologies and industry trends. Front-end development tools encompass a wide range of software and frameworks that help developers create and optimize the client side of web applications.

Guarantee: Job or 100% money back

full-stack developer

Remember, choosing a technology you enjoy working with and that aligns with your career goals will significantly enhance your learning experience and future prospects. Apart from interviews, they are crucial for understanding core programming concepts, problem-solving, and optimizing code efficiency. Strong DS&A skills enable you to design effective solutions and write better Java code.

FAQ’s – Full Stack Developer Roadmap

full-stack developer

Software developers require slightly different skills, tools, and software knowledge for frontend and backend development. However, full-stack development combines both disciplines—meaning teams can build applications from start to finish in an integrated and cohesive manner. A full-stack application is a software application that encompasses both frontend and backend in a single code base.

  • Organizations adopting full-stack development strategies experience the following benefits.
  • This type of specialized software developer is involved with all aspects of the development process, from client-facing user experience design to server-side database management.
  • Front-End Developers are responsible for creating a website’s layout and color scheme — along with interactive elements like forms and buttons.
  • They possess a holistic understanding of web development, allowing them to create fully functional and dynamic applications independently or as part of a team.
  • In this roadmap article, we have discussed all the topics which are needed to become a full-stack developer.

Leave a Reply